What is a company hackathon?
A hackathon is a concentrated event which usually runs for 24–48 hours in which engineers and creatives come together in teams to design, build and demonstrate a new feature or product.

What is hack day?
A hackathon (also known as a hack day, hackfest, datathon or codefest; a portmanteau of hacking marathon) is a design sprint-like event; often, in which computer programmers and others involved in software development, including graphic designers, interface designers, project managers, domain experts, and others …

How do you lead a hackathon team?
If you’re the team lead, remember two things:
- You can’t do it alone, so delegate tasks in consideration of scope and skill level.
- Stay open and collaborative — but stick to the initial vision. Never allow suggestions that fall outside of scope to influence the project’s journey.

How much does it cost to host a hackathon?
Typical budgets can range anywhere from $5,000 to $80,000. You’ll need to customize the hackathon to work for your needs and goals.

How long do hackathons last?
Typically, Hackathons run between 1-3 days (24- 72 hours). Some Hackathons last 4-5 days. It really boils down to your goal and your project plan. You will want to schedule enough time for teams to make real progress.

How do you beat hackathon Quora?
That said, these are my tips to have a good start in a hackathon:
- Read the rules and pay attention to instructions. Different hackathons have different goals.
- Download things before the event.
- Choose your stack wisely.
- Don’t waste time with details.
- Don’t underestimate your demo / pitch.
